Eagle Bridge, New York Climate and Weather
Current Weather in Eagle Bridge
In the month of December, Eagle Bridge experiences an average high temperature of 36 degrees Fahrenheit. Low temperaturs in December are usually about 17 degrees with an average rainfall of 2.47 inches. The seasonal climate varies in Eagle Bridge with daytime temperatures averaging 78 degrees in the summer, and 34 degrees in the winter months. Visitors can also expect Eagle Bridge to receive an average of 2.25 inches of rainfall per/month during winter months and 3.36 inches of rainfall per/month in the summer months. The temperature has been known to get as high as 100 degrees in the summer and as low as -36 degrees in the winter so visitors planning a vacation to Eagle Bridge should check the weather forecast to determine proper attire prior to departure. Burden Iron Works - Troy, The Burden Iron Works was an iron works and industrial complex on the Hudson River and Wynantskill Creek in Troy, New York. It once housed the Burden Water Wheel, the most powerful vertical water wheel in history. It most likely inspired George Washington Ferris to build the Ferris wheel.
